from __future__ import annotations
import uuid
from fastapi import APIRouter, Depends, HTTPException
from pydantic import BaseModel, Field
from auth import hash_password, require_admin_dep, require_auth
from db import get_db, row_to_dict
router = APIRouter(prefix="/api/users", tags=["users"])
PUBLIC_FIELDS = "id, email, name, role, status, tier_id, created"
class CreateUserRequest(BaseModel):
email: str
name: str = Field(min_length=1)
password: str = Field(min_length=4)
role: str = "user"
class PatchUserRequest(BaseModel):
name: str | None = None
role: str | None = None
status: str | None = None
password: str | None = None
def _active_admin_count(conn, exclude_id: str | None = None) -> int:
if exclude_id:
row = conn.execute(
"SELECT COUNT(*) AS n FROM profiles WHERE role = 'admin' AND status = 'active' AND id != ?",
(exclude_id,),
).fetchone()
else:
row = conn.execute(
"SELECT COUNT(*) AS n FROM profiles WHERE role = 'admin' AND status = 'active'"
).fetchone()
return int(row["n"])
@router.get("")
def list_users(session: dict = Depends(require_admin_dep)):
with get_db() as conn:
rows = conn.execute(f"SELECT {PUBLIC_FIELDS} FROM profiles ORDER BY created").fetchall()
return [row_to_dict(row) for row in rows]
@router.post("")
def create_user(req: CreateUserRequest, session: dict = Depends(require_admin_dep)):
if req.role not in {"user", "admin"}:
raise HTTPException(400, "Rolle muss user oder admin sein")
profile_id = str(uuid.uuid4())
try:
with get_db() as conn:
conn.execute(
"""
INSERT INTO profiles (id, email, name, password_hash, role, status, tier_id)
VALUES (?, ?, ?, ?, ?, 'active', 'local')
""",
(
profile_id,
req.email.lower().strip(),
req.name.strip(),
hash_password(req.password),
req.role,
),
)
prof = row_to_dict(conn.execute(f"SELECT {PUBLIC_FIELDS} FROM profiles WHERE id = ?", (profile_id,)).fetchone())
except Exception as exc:
if "UNIQUE" in str(exc).upper():
raise HTTPException(409, "E-Mail ist bereits vergeben") from exc
raise
return prof
@router.patch("/{profile_id}")
def patch_user(profile_id: str, req: PatchUserRequest, session: dict = Depends(require_admin_dep)):
with get_db() as conn:
current = row_to_dict(conn.execute("SELECT * FROM profiles WHERE id = ?", (profile_id,)).fetchone())
if not current:
raise HTTPException(404, "Nutzer nicht gefunden")
name = req.name.strip() if req.name is not None else current["name"]
role = req.role if req.role is not None else current["role"]
status = req.status if req.status is not None else current["status"]
if role not in {"user", "admin"}:
raise HTTPException(400, "Rolle muss user oder admin sein")
if status not in {"active", "disabled"}:
raise HTTPException(400, "Status muss active oder disabled sein")
becomes_non_admin = current["role"] == "admin" and (role != "admin" or status == "disabled")
if becomes_non_admin and _active_admin_count(conn, exclude_id=profile_id) < 1:
raise HTTPException(400, "Der letzte aktive Admin kann nicht entfernt werden")
password_hash = current["password_hash"]
if req.password:
if len(req.password) < 4:
raise HTTPException(400, "Passwort muss mind. 4 Zeichen haben")
password_hash = hash_password(req.password)
conn.execute(
"""
UPDATE profiles SET name = ?, role = ?, status = ?, password_hash = ?
WHERE id = ?
""",
(name, role, status, password_hash, profile_id),
)
if status == "disabled":
conn.execute("DELETE FROM sessions WHERE profile_id = ?", (profile_id,))
return row_to_dict(conn.execute(f"SELECT {PUBLIC_FIELDS} FROM profiles WHERE id = ?", (profile_id,)).fetchone())
@router.get("/me")
def my_account(session: dict = Depends(require_auth)):
with get_db() as conn:
prof = row_to_dict(
conn.execute(
f"SELECT {PUBLIC_FIELDS} FROM profiles WHERE id = ?",
(session["profile_id"],),
).fetchone()
)
if not prof:
raise HTTPException(401, "Profil nicht gefunden")
return prof
